Have you restarted or otherwise executed your autoexec.bat file?  What
platform are you using?  The best way to set environment variables is to do
so through the Control Panel.  On Windows 2000, Control
Panel->System->Advanced->Environment Variables.

Have you verified that TOMCAT_HOME has a value?
